当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

vmware虚拟机光盘映像文件下载,VMware虚拟机光盘映像文件全攻略,下载、制作与应用指南(3186字)

vmware虚拟机光盘映像文件下载,VMware虚拟机光盘映像文件全攻略,下载、制作与应用指南(3186字)

VMware虚拟机光盘映像文件全攻略详解了ISO文件下载、制作与实战应用方法,内容涵盖官方镜像安全获取途径(包括Windows/Linux系统主流版本)、手动制作流程(...

vmware虚拟机光盘映像文件全攻略详解了ISO文件下载、制作与实战应用方法,内容涵盖官方镜像安全获取途径(包括Windows/Linux系统主流版本)、手动制作流程(环境配置、工具选择、兼容性检查)、虚拟机部署技巧(VMware Player/Workstation配置参数优化)及常见问题解决方案,重点解析了ISO文件校验机制、虚拟机资源分配策略、多系统共存配置原则,并提供应用场景指南(系统测试、开发环境搭建、软件兼容性验证),特别强调资源管理技巧与版本更新注意事项,帮助用户高效构建虚拟化工作平台,适用于IT运维、软件开发及教育实验等多领域需求。

VMware虚拟化技术概述与光盘映像核心概念

1 虚拟化技术发展脉络

自2001年VMware推出首款商业虚拟化软件以来,虚拟化技术经历了三代演进:Type-1裸机虚拟化(ESXi)、Type-2宿主虚拟化(Workstation/Player)和容器化技术(VMware vSphere),Type-2架构的VMware Workstation因其用户友好性成为主流开发工具,其核心组件之一的虚拟光驱系统(Virtual CD/DVD Drive)支持多种光盘映像格式(ISO、VMDK、QCOW2等)。

2 光盘映像技术原理

虚拟光驱通过驱动程序与宿主操作系统交互,将二进制文件映射为虚拟光驱设备,ISO 9660标准定义的ISO文件采用分层目录结构,包含主目录、元数据区(Rock Ridge/UDF扩展)和错误校正码(ECC),VMware的VMDK格式则采用流式存储技术,支持增量更新和差分卷功能。

3 关键技术参数对比

格式 文件结构 存储效率 扩展性 兼容性
ISO 分层目录树 有限 通用
VMDK 流式二进制流 VMware专属
QCOW2 增量映射 VMware/KVM
VDF 分块存储 极高 极高 虚拟化平台

VMware虚拟光驱系统架构解析

1 虚拟光驱驱动模型

VMware Workstation采用分层驱动架构:

  1. 用户接口层:提供GUI操作面板和命令行工具(vmware-vcd)
  2. 核心服务层:管理光驱状态和文件映射
  3. 系统调用层:与Windows API(WDM驱动)或Linux内核模块交互

2 设备树管理机制

在Windows环境下,虚拟光驱通过设备树(Device Tree)注册为"CD-ROM"类设备,其标识符为{\3636E3F0-C9DA-11D2-BB9E-00C04F3EFE82},设备属性包括:

vmware虚拟机光盘映像文件下载,VMware虚拟机光盘映像文件全攻略,下载、制作与应用指南(3186字)

图片来源于网络,如有侵权联系删除

  • 介质类型(ISO 9660/UDF)
  • 容量限制(最大支持16TB)
  • 错误处理策略(自动修复/忽略)

3 虚拟存储优化技术

VMware采用内存映射技术(Memory-Mapped Files)提升读取性能,当文件小于物理内存时,直接加载内存;超过时采用磁盘缓存机制,对于大文件(>4GB),自动启用分页存储(Pagefile)技术。

官方渠道与第三方资源获取方案

1 VMware官方镜像获取

VMware官方不直接提供操作系统ISO镜像,但提供以下合法获取途径:

  1. vSphere Hypervisor(ESXi)社区版:通过VMware官网下载
  2. Workstation Player试用版:包含5个虚拟机实例配额
  3. vSphere Client(HTML5)集成环境:支持通过vCenter管理ISO部署

2 开源替代方案

  • OpenVMware项目:提供ESXi 5.5/6.0的社区版镜像(需自行验证许可证)
  • Proxmox VE:集成Debian系统的虚拟化平台(包含预装ISO)
  • QEMU/KVM:开源虚拟化方案(需自行制作镜像)

3 第三方资源平台对比

平台 镜像类型 下载量(月) 安全认证 更新频率
Softpedia ISO/VMDK 850k MD5校验 每周
Tucows 多系统镜像 420k SHA-256 每日
SourceForge 开源项目镜像 180k 病毒扫描 每月
Oracle JRE Java运行时镜像 65k 官方认证 实时

4 镜像获取最佳实践

  1. 使用BitTorrent协议(推荐下载量>1TB的镜像)
  2. 启用HTTP Range Request优化断点续传
  3. 配置代理服务器(支持SNI协议)
  4. 实施镜像哈希验证(推荐SHA-384算法)

专业级镜像制作指南

1 Windows系统镜像制作

使用Rufus工具制作U盘启动盘:

  1. 选择ISO文件(推荐ISO-9660格式)
  2. 配置分区方案(MBR/GPT)
  3. 启用SHA-256校验
  4. 添加启动菜单(多系统支持)

2 Linux发行版定制

针对Ubuntu镜像的定制流程:

# 使用ISOLinux工具制作
isohybrid Ubuntu-22.04 ISO
# 添加自定义元数据
genisoimage -d "Custom Title" -V "Custom Volume" -o Ubuntu-custom.iso Ubuntu

3 VMDK格式转换

使用VMware vSphere Client进行格式转换:

  1. 选择源文件(ISO/VMDK)
  2. 配置目标格式(VMDK/OVA)
  3. 设置存储优化(Split/Concatenate)
  4. 启用快照功能(保留转换过程)

4 增量镜像管理

创建差分VMDK的步骤:

  1. 新建基础VMDK(100GB)
  2. 安装操作系统并配置初始设置
  3. 创建差分卷(.vmdk文件)
  4. 实施版本控制(Git管理配置文件)

高级应用场景与性能调优

1 虚拟光驱性能优化

  • 启用NAT加速模式(降低CPU占用)
  • 配置内存缓存(建议值:15-20%物理内存)
  • 使用SSD存储(读取速度提升300%+)

2 安全防护机制

  • 启用硬件级加密(AES-256)
  • 部署虚拟光驱白名单(仅允许特定哈希值)
  • 实施沙箱隔离(限制写操作)

3 跨平台兼容方案

  • Windows与Linux混合环境配置
  • MAC系统通过Parallels Tools实现兼容
  • iOS/Android设备远程访问(需要vCenter连接)

4 大规模部署方案

使用PowerShell批量部署脚本:

vmware虚拟机光盘映像文件下载,VMware虚拟机光盘映像文件全攻略,下载、制作与应用指南(3186字)

图片来源于网络,如有侵权联系删除

# 定义ISO路径和存储位置
$isoPath = "C:\ ISO\ Library"
$targetStore = "D:\ VMStore"
# 创建存储目录
New-Item -ItemType Directory -Path $targetStore -Force
# 遍历所有ISO文件
Get-ChildItem $isoPath | ForEach-Object {
    $isoFile = $_.FullName
    $vmName = $_.BaseName
    $vmPath = Join-Path $targetStore $vmName
    # 创建虚拟机基础配置
    New-VM -Name $vmName -PowerState Off -DomainController $dcServer
    # 添加虚拟光驱
    Add-VMDevice -VM $vmName -DeviceType "CdRom" -Path $isoFile
    # 启动虚拟机
    Start-VM $vmName
}

常见问题与故障排查

1 典型错误代码解析

错误代码 描述 解决方案
0x00000001 驱动加载失败 更新VMware Tools
0x0000000A 介质容量不足 扩展虚拟硬盘
0x0000000F 校验和错误 重新下载镜像
0x00000012 系统资源不足 升级内存配置

2 虚拟光驱不识别处理

  1. 重新安装VMware Workstation(需卸载旧版本)
  2. 更新设备驱动(通过设备管理器)
  3. 检查系统服务状态(VMware Tools服务)
  4. 执行注册表修复(H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Class{4D36E973-E3AB-11CE-BF44-00C04FB983FC})

3 大文件传输优化

使用VMware Shared Folders的改进方案:

  1. 配置NFSv4协议(性能提升40%)
  2. 启用压缩传输(建议值:Zlib-9)
  3. 实施断点续传(HTTP Range请求)
  4. 使用多线程传输(建议值:16-24线程)

未来发展趋势与技术前瞻

1 虚拟光驱技术演进

  • 容器化集成:将ISO镜像转换为OCI兼容格式
  • AI驱动优化:基于机器学习的性能预测
  • 区块链存证:镜像哈希上链验证

2 安全技术融合

  • 零信任架构:动态验证每个镜像访问权限
  • 隐私计算:同态加密存储敏感镜像
  • 联邦学习:分布式环境下的镜像协同

3 绿色计算实践

  • 智能休眠技术:空闲时自动降频
  • 碳足迹追踪:计算镜像生命周期排放
  • 虚拟化能效优化:动态调整资源分配

法律与伦理规范

1 版权法规解读

  • ISO 9660标准实施规范(ISO/IEC 13346:2015)
  • 计算机软件保护条例(中国)
  • DMCA合规指南(美国)

2 开源协议合规

  • GPL v3兼容性审查
  • Apache 2.0协议应用场景
  • MIT许可证使用限制

3 数据隐私保护

  • GDPR合规存储要求
  • 中国个人信息保护法实施
  • 跨境数据传输规范

行业应用案例研究

1 金融行业应用

某银行灾备系统采用:

  • 200+虚拟光驱实例
  • 每秒处理1200个ISO文件
  • RPO=0技术方案
  • 每年节省物理服务器成本$2.3M

2 教育行业实践

清华大学虚拟化实验室配置:

  • 5000个共享虚拟光驱
  • 支持多版本ISO并发访问
  • 每日访问量120万次
  • 资源利用率提升65%

3 科研机构方案

CERN虚拟化平台特点:

  • 支持PB级镜像存储
  • 实现GPU加速读取
  • 采用纠删码存储(EC=6/12)
  • 每年处理300TB镜像数据

总结与展望

经过系统性研究可以发现,VMware虚拟机光盘映像文件作为虚拟化生态的基础组件,其管理技术正经历从传统存储向智能处理的范式转变,随着5G网络、边缘计算和量子存储等技术的成熟,虚拟光驱系统将演变为分布式计算单元的核心接口,建议从业者关注以下发展趋势:

  1. 基于区块链的镜像存证技术
  2. AI驱动的自动化镜像管理
  3. 光子计算架构下的光存储方案
  4. 跨平台统一管理接口标准

(全文共计3186字,技术细节更新至2023年Q3版本)

黑狐家游戏

发表评论

最新文章